Telegram CEO Durov Defies Russian Wanted List Over Spy Claims
Russia placed Telegram founder Pavel Durov on a wanted list, accusing the platform of aiding Ukrainian intelligence in recruiting Russians for sabotage. Durov responded with a middle-finger gesture, escalating tensions. The move follows broader Russian efforts to control digital communications amid the war.
